Legal Information Management (LIM) is a small, woman-owned business using databases to help companies manage and publish their important information on desktops, networks, and the Web. LIM was founded in 1984 by yours truly, Ann DiLoreto, MLS. Recently, after 25 years in Emerald Hills overlooking Silicon Valley, I relocated my small office, home office to the hills overlooking the Kohala Coast on the Big Island of Hawaii. Since 1984, I have provided over 450 firms with database solutions. Current clients include an economic think tank, a historical research library, a seminary college, an intelligence & security contractor, a rural poor advocacy group, a public works department, a private art museum, a medical device manufacturer, a county court library, a local public utility, a police officer training commission, an employee advcocacy foundation, and of course, law firms.
About me: after earning an M.L.S. Simmons School of Library and Information Science and managing the libraries of private law firms for eight years, I left Boston to become an entrepreneur in the earlier days of the "dotcom" era in Silicon Valley. At that time I started Legal Information Management to help librarians automate their libraries and over the years, have lectured, given seminars and held training workshops.
